I think Anthropic and OpenAI have found product-market fit (simonwillison.net)

🤖 AI Summary
Anthropic and OpenAI appear to have achieved a significant product-market fit, as evidenced by reports that Anthropic may be moving towards its first profitable quarter. Companies are noticing skyrocketing expenses associated with their AI usage, particularly for coding agents like Claude Code and Codex. Both companies recently adjusted their pricing plans to align more closely with API token usage, marking a shift away from previously offered discounts and indicating a transition to more substantial revenue streams from enterprise customers. This development is crucial for the AI/ML community, as it suggests that businesses are beginning to recognize the value of coding agents in driving productivity and efficiency. The pricing changes mean that enterprise customers are now paying rates closer to API prices, which could significantly enhance revenue potential for both Anthropic and OpenAI, especially in light of their intentions to pursue IPOs. Additionally, the sharp increase in API costs and the shift to enterprise-focused pricing illustrate how essential coding agents have become in professional settings, hinting at a new growth phase for AI technologies in commercial applications.
